In September 2023, Larissa had the opportunity to meet Tyler Joersz, one of the two founders of TYDE Music. During this first encounter, she played a Redwood tenor ukulele and immediately fell in love with its sound, craftsmanship, and feel. From that moment, a connection was formed that would grow far beyond a single meeting.
Shortly after, Larissa began a nearly two-year project together with Tyler Joersz and Devin Price, the other founder of TYDE Music: the creation of a custom baritone ukulele built from koa wood and myrtlewood, featuring Larissa’s personal signature as an inlay. Instrument number 241 was ultimately named “Rucola Risa” — Larissa, as the first European ambassador of TYDE Music, is accompanied on her journeys around the world by its warm tonewoods and rich sound, supporting her percussive playing.
TYDE Music was founded in 2010 by self-taught luthiers Tyler Joersz and Devin Price. Starting with ukuleles made from leftover materials, their passion for music and craftsmanship grew into a full instrument-making company.
Music remains at the heart of their work, bringing together art, history, and skill in instruments that inspire players worldwide.
